How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cambridge Highlands?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cambridge Highlands Studio Apartments | $2,809 | $1,717 | $9,927 |
| Cambridge Highlands 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,395 | $825 | $10,000+ |
| Cambridge Highlands 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,883 | $1,799 | $10,000+ |
Cambridge Highlands 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,041 | $1,232 | $10,000+ |
| Cambridge Highlands 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,869 | $800 | $10,000+ |
| Cambridge Highlands 5 Bedroom Apartments | $6,298 | $4,350 | $9,500 |
| Cambridge Highlands 6 Bedroom Apartments | $7,397 | $1,000 | $9,600 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 3 Bedroom Cambridge Highlands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Cambridge Highlands with 3 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 3 Bedroom in Cambridge Highlands is at Blair Pond Estates listed at $3,050.
How much is the average rent for a 3 Bedroom Cambridge Highlands Apartment?
The average rent for a 3 Bedroom Apartment in Cambridge Highlands is $4,041.
What is the largest available 3 Bedroom Cambridge Highlands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Cambridge Highlands is a 1,515 square feet unit starting from $5,105 at The Cantabrigia.
What is the average size for Cambridge Highlands 3 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 3 Bedroom rental in Cambridge Highlands is currently 3,332 sq ft.
